Output d63c29b5a4b5901fa68ebda1c463fd85e9e02b68ed976bf05a8b9724b849df97:45

value
29813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744431b7318aa26c88a6ce787024eb6b2c16c8d1 OP_EQUAL
address
3CHn11fYMqdJcERkDB6F7VnF394nu77EM9
transaction
d63c29b5a4b5901fa68ebda1c463fd85e9e02b68ed976bf05a8b9724b849df97
confirmations
159242
spent
true